乳腺DISCO-VIBRANT与常规DCE-VIBRANT动态增强MRI的图像质量对比研究OA
Comparative study of image quality of dynamic enhancement MRI between DISCO-VIBRANT and conventional DCE-VIBRANT for breast
目的:对比研究基于笛卡尔采集的K空间共享三维容积快速动态成像(DISCO)结合乳腺容积成像(VIBRANT)序列(DISCO-VIBRANT)和常规动态增强的乳腺容积成像(DCE-VIBRANT)两种乳腺磁共振成像(MRI)动态增强图像质量的优劣,为临床合理应用DCE技术提供依据.方法:回顾性选取2024年1月至2025年6月利辛县人民医院收治的54例临床初诊乳腺病变的患者,依据乳腺超声和数字X射线病灶初步发现将其分为DISCO-VIBRANT组(26例)和常规 DCE-VIBRANT组(28例).采用Pioneer 3.0T磁共振扫描仪,分别选取DISCO-VIBRANT第10期、常规DCE-VIBRANT第3期的图像,在乳腺腺体、病灶、脂肪区域放置感兴趣区域(ROI)测量信号强度和背景信号强度,计算信噪比(SNR)、对比噪声比(CNR)等指标,并由两名医生对图像质量进行主观评价.结果:DISCO-VIBRANT组的乳腺病灶、腺体、脂肪、背景信号、SNR及CNR图像上的信号强度(SI)平均值分别为975.74±453.13、413.56±118.12、76.85±25.65、2.77±1.16、167.30±74.09和217.18±187.53;常规DCE-VIBRANT组分别为1 441.17±336.80、508.16±143.57、190.48±49.47、10.90±3.47、50.11±17.79和93.14±40.30.两组乳腺病灶、腺体、脂肪、背景信号4项之和分别为1 468.91±493.03、2 150.71±448.93,差异有统计学意义(t=-5.319,P<0.05).图像整体质量及病灶与分辨率、脂肪腺体区分、对诊断帮助程度在DISCO-VIBRANT组主观评分M(Q1,Q3)分别为4(4,5)、4(4,4)、4(4,5)和4(4,5),两名医生一致性评估的Kappa值为0.743、0.612、0.772和0.625.常规DCE-VIBRANT组的主观评分分别为5(5,5)、5(5,5)、5(5,5)和5(5,5),两名医生一致性评估的Kappa值为0.781、0.711、0.781和0.650.常规DCE-VIBRANT组所有主观评分均高于DISCO-VIBRANT组,两名医生具有较高的一致性,Kappa值0.612~0.781.DISCO-VIBRANT组与常规DCE-VIBRANT组扫描时间分别为3 min 36 s和8 min 43 s.结论:在扫描速度、噪声控制和提供定量参数方面DISCO-VIBRANT技术优于常规DCE-VIBRANT技术,而常规DCE-VIBRANT空间分辨率更高,在显示乳腺导管、微小肿瘤血管方面具有优势,临床可依据诊断需求选择合适的MRI动态增强技术.
Objective:To compare and study the advantages and disadvantages of image quality of dynamic enhancement of two kinds of magnetic resonance imaging(MRI)for breast,which include Cartesian sampling-based k-space shared three-dimensional volumetric fast dynamic imaging(DISCO)that combined with volumetric imaging for breast assessment(VIBRANT)sequence(DISCO-VIBRANT)for breast,and conventional dynamic contrast-enhanced volumetric imaging(DCE-VIBRANT)for the breast,so as to provide basis for clinically rational application of DCE technique.Methods:A total of fifty-four patients with breast lesions who were clinically preliminarily diagnosed by People's Hospital of Lixin County from January 2024 to June 2025 were enrolled.According to preliminary findings of breast ultrasound and digital X-ray for lesions,the patients were divided into DISCO-VIBRANT group(n=26)and conventional DCE-VIBRANT group(n=28).The Pioneer 3.0T MRI scanner was adopted,and the images of the 10th phase of DISCO-VIBRANT,and the images of the 3rd phase of conventional DCE-VIBRANT were respectively selected.Regions of interest(ROIs)were placed at glandular tissue of the mammary gland,lesions,and fat areas to measure signal intensity and signal intensity of background.The signal-to-noise ratio(SNR)and contrast-to-noise ratio(CNR)were calculated.Subjective evaluation of image quality was performed by two radiologists.Results:In the DISCO-VIBRANT group,the mean of signal intensity(SI)of lesions,glands,fats,background signals,SNR and CNR on images were respectively 975.74±453.13,413.56±118.12,76.85±25.65,2.77±1.16,167.30±74.09 and 217.18±187.53.The above indicators of the conventional DCE-VIBRANT group were respectively 1 441.17±336.80,508.16±143.57,190.48±49.47,10.90±3.47,50.11±17.79 and 93.14±40.30.The total sum of the four indicators(lesions of breast,glands,fat,and background signal)was 1468.91±493.03 in the DISCO-VIBRANT group,and that was 2 150.71±448.93 in the conventional DCE-VIBRANT group,and the difference was statistically significant(t=-5.319,P<0.05).The subjective scores[M(Q1,Q3)]of overall image quality,lesion resolution,differentiation between fat and glands,and the degree of helping diagnosis of the DISCO-VIBRANT group were respectively 4(4,5),4(4,4),4(4,5)and 4(4,5).The Kappa values of consistent assessment between two radiologists were respectively 0.743,0.612,0.772,and 0.625.The subjective scores of the above indicators were respectively 5(5,5),5(5,5),5(5,5),and 5(5,5)in the conventional DCE-VIBRANT group,and the Kappa values of them were respectively 0.781,0.711,0.781,and 0.650.All of subjective scores in the conventional DCE-VIBRANT group were higher than those in the DISCO-VIBRANT group,and there were higher consistency between two radiologists,and the range of Kappa values was from 0.612 to 0.781.The scanning times of the DISCO-VIBRANT group and the conventional DCE-VIBRANT group were respectively 3 min 36 s and 8 min 43 s.Conclusion:The DISCO-VIBRANT technique is superior to conventional DCE-VIBRANT in terms of scanning speed,noise control,and provision of quantitative parameters.However,conventional DCE-VIBRANT has higher spatial resolution,and has advantages in displaying breast ducts and small blood vessels of tumor.Clinical operation should select appropriate MRI dynamic contrast-enhanced technique according to diagnostic needs.
